随笔分类 -  剑指offer

摘要:输入一个链表,用反向输出链表的节点。 可以用栈保存的遍历的链表节点的值。然后用栈先进后出的特点。就可以实现从尾到头输出节点值。#include#include#include#include#include#includeusing namespace std;int... 阅读全文
posted @ 2017-12-30 19:44 __NaCl 阅读(272) 评论(0) 推荐(0)
摘要:请实现一个函数,将一个字符串中的空格替换成“%20”。例如,当字符串为We Are Happy.则经过替换之后的字符串为We%20Are%20Happy。 一开始的思路便是从开头扫到右空格就替换,但这样做,空格后的每个字符串都要推后,这样时间复杂度就是O(n2)。 所... 阅读全文
posted @ 2017-12-30 19:13 __NaCl 阅读(152) 评论(0) 推荐(0)
摘要:题意: 在一个二维数组中,每一行都按照从左到右递增的顺序排序,每一列都按照从上到下递增的顺序排序。请完成一个函数,输入这样的一个二维数组和一个整数,判断数组中是否含有该整数。 思路: 因为数组是有序,从左到右递增,从上到下递增。那我们可以从左下或者右上开始查找。比如我... 阅读全文
posted @ 2017-12-29 23:12 __NaCl 阅读(141) 评论(0) 推荐(0)